Origin:
Bred by David Reath (United States, before 1974).
Introduced in United States by Reath's Nursery in 1979 as 'Royal Rose'.
Class:
Hybrid / Species crosses.  
Bloom:
Pink.  Semi-double, flat bloom form.  Early.  
Habit:

Height: up to 30" (up to 75cm).  
Growing:
USDA zone 2a and warmer.  
Patents:
Patent status unknown (to HelpMeFind).
Ploidy:
Diploid
Notes:
First bloomed 1974, registered 1979. Sibling of 'Salmon Dream'
